This is probably the best year to leave for a HC job if you're a top candidate. In fact, this is unprecedented with how many top tier HC jobs are open, or about to be open. The following top jobs are open: LSU, USC, TCU, Va Tech. The following jobs will likely be open soon: UF, Miami, Baylor, SMU.

If Elko wants to be a HC, then he will leave after this year. Strike while the iron is hot.
